B&N Senior Bridge Engineer Responsibilities:

  • Manage the delivery of bridge design projects, ensuring a high-quality, client-focused experience for agencies such as GDOT, as well as cities and counties throughout Georgia
  • Lead bridge design and production efforts for GDOT and local agency projects
  • Monitor project performance, including scope, budgets, schedules, and risk management
  • Collaborate with technical experts and project teams across the firm to solve complex engineering challenges
  • Support project pursuits and contribute to proposal development
  • Play a role in shaping B&N’s Bridge Services marketing strategy, with a focus on repeat work and client growth
  • Coach and mentor junior staff while collaborating with licensed engineers firmwide

Skills &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in civil or structural engineering from an ABET-accredited program
  • Professional Engineer (PE) license in Georgia, or the ability to obtain licensure through reciprocity
  • 10+ years of related bridge design experience, prior experience with GDOT projects required.  Local government experience in Georgia is desirable.
  • Experience with proposal development and client relationship management is advantageous
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office
  • Experience with MicroStation or equivalent CAD software, and bridge design software, familiarity with OpenBridge Modeler is a plus
  • Strong communication, leadership, and collaboration skills
  • Self-motivated and adaptable, with the ability to work effectively in a virtual and collaborative environment
